RESIDENTS from HC-One Wales’s Abermill Care Home in Abertridwr, Caerphilly, enjoyed a delightful day out at Caerphilly Garden Centre, immersing themselves in the sights and scents of the vibrant flower displays. The visit provided the perfect opportunity for residents to relax and enjoy a hot chocolate or a warming cup of tea while soaking up the garden’s peaceful atmosphere.
The outing also included a scenic drive through Caerphilly town, offering residents breathtaking views of Caerphilly Castle and the surrounding mountains. Many shared how much they appreciated the chance to get out and experience the local area, making memories together in their community.
Activities like these are an important part of Abermill’s commitment to enhancing the wellbeing and quality of life of its residents, offering opportunities for social connection, enjoyment, and engagement with the local area.
Stephanie Williams, Home Manager at Abermill Care Home said: “It was wonderful to see our residents enjoying a change of scenery and spending time together in such a beautiful setting.
“These outings are about more than just a trip, they bring joy, conversation, and connection to our residents’ day.”
